There are much better options out there
Administration Officer Drug and Alcohol (Current Employee) - Sydney Olympic Park NSW - 27 July 2019
Indeed Featured review
The most useful review selected by IndeedA bit of a tricky place to navigate. Cliquey, and full of overpromoted, inexperienced middle managers who are friends of friends, and so now their recent promotions makes sense.
These people appear resentful of now being office based, and making it their mission to ensure that the larger teams working lives are made hellish day to day. No appreciation of the hard work.
